Beijing pushes back on FBI claims of Chinese ‘police stations’ in U.S.

Por: NBC News Nation November 19, 2022

thumbnail

China on Friday pushed back on claims it was operating ‘police stations’ on U.S. soil, calling the sites volunteer-run, after the FBI director said he was “very concerned” about unauthorized stations that have been linked to Beijing’s influence operations. Safeguard Defenders, a Europe-based human rights organization, published a report in September revealing the presence of dozens of Chinese police “service stations” in major... + full article
